I assumed that the TR4-250 scuttle vents would be like the TR3 vent and similar 
to the MGB scuttle vent.

The TR3 scuttle vent is an opening in the scuttle with a drain tray under it, 
and a hose to drain water collected in the drain tray.  The vent is at the top 
facing forward and the lower opening faces the bulkhead.  The air flow is 'U' 
shaped.  The air does exit above the cylinder shaped radiator core, but I think 
it comes in in the heater hot air exit direction.

The MGB has a scuttle vent that goes down into a box just inside the bulkhead.  
There is a drain tube at the bottom of the box and the vent opening is inside 
the car on the side of the box, unlike the TR3 with its vent on the outside 
playing air scoop.

The Land Rover has two long scuttle vents that reach the width of the car. Like 
the TR3 the Land Rover vents are on the outside.  These are vertical straight 
through holes with optional bug screens.
